Responsibilities:

  • To maximize room sales and revenue.

  • To maximize employee productivity through the use of multi-skilling, multi-tasking, and flexible scheduling to meet the financial goals of the business, as well as the expectations of the guests.

  • To ensure that the Reservations operate with the lowest possible cost structure while also delivering on the brand promise to the guest proactively managing costs based on key performance indicators.

  • To help prepare the Annual Business Plan.

  • To assist in monthly forecasting‌.

  • Ensure that all relevant hotels, company, and local rules, policies, and regulations are adhered to, including credit and payment policies.

  • To actively take part in weekly yield and revenue management meetings, preparing the information and reports as necessary to ensure a productive meeting.

  • To assist in the preparation, utilization, and update of an annual Marketing Plan, broken down as necessary by the department.

  • To oversee the taking and processing of all room reservations according to hotel and company guidelines.

  • To administer the loading of all new rates into the relevant reservation systems, including testing and deployment.

  • To work with other departments, checking the room and room-type availability, to maximize room sales, yield, and average room rate through upselling and other inventory and rate management initiatives.

  • To oversee and assist with the processing of individual and group reservations, rooming lists, waitlists, and other reservations.

  • To ensure the proper handling of all overbooking situations and wait-listed business, working closely with the relevant departments.

  • To prepare accurate advance booking counts and forecasts.

  • To build strong relationships with all sources of bookings and work closely with the Marketing Department in maintaining and developing these relationships.
